About

Facing something new can be exciting-and a little scary too. For many children, getting a haircut for the first time is filled with unknowns: unfamiliar places, strange sounds, and the sensation of someone snipping near their head. This gentle, honest picture book helps children navigate the experience with confidence, curiosity, and calm.
Told through warm, reassuring language and accompanied by soft, expressive illustrations, the story walks young readers through each step of what they might encounter at a salon or barbershop. From talking with a grown-up before the big day to hearing the snip-snip of scissors or the gentle buzz of clippers, every moment is shown with care and empathy. Children are reminded that it's okay to feel unsure-and that they can ask questions, bring a comfort item, or even giggle when hair tickles their nose.
Ideal for parents, teachers, and caregivers who want to prepare a child for their first haircut, this story emphasizes emotional awareness and self-assurance. It's a thoughtful tool for building resilience during everyday milestones. Whether read aloud at home or in a classroom, it creates a safe space to talk about feelings, foster bravery, and make the unfamiliar a little more familiar.
